Frankfurt am Main (FRA) to Jeddah (JED)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Frankfurt am Main International Airport (FRA) in Frankfurt am Main, Germany to King Abdulaziz International Airport (JED) in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ia is 4,133 kilometers (2,568 miles / 2,232 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 6h, flying southeast at a heading of 128°.
